Overview of Industrial Light Towers
Industrial light towers are versatile lighting solutions designed to illuminate large outdoor areas, making them essential for various applications such as construction sites, events, and emergency response scenarios. These mobile lighting units are equipped with high-intensity lights mounted on adjustable towers that can extend to significant heights, allowing for widespread illumination. Their portability and ease of setup make them ideal for temporary lighting needs, helping workers to perform tasks safely and efficiently during nighttime or low-light conditions.
One of the key features of industrial light towers is their ability to produce powerful and adjustable lighting. Most models are equipped with LED or halogen lights that provide high lumen output, ensuring bright and clear visibility over considerable distances. Additionally, many light towers come with features such as a variable height mechanism, allowing users to customize the light’s range and direction according to the specific requirements of the task at hand.
Furthermore, the best industrial light towers are designed with durability and reliability in mind. They often feature rugged construction materials that can withstand harsh environmental conditions, including extreme temperatures, rain, and wind. This durability ensures that they can operate effectively in challenging conditions, making them indispensable in industries such as construction, mining, and disaster recovery.
In recent years, advancements in technology have led to the development of more energy-efficient and environmentally friendly models. Many modern industrial light towers utilize solar power or hybrid fuel options, which not only reduce operating costs but also minimize their carbon footprint. As a result, businesses are increasingly looking for the best industrial light towers that not only meet their lighting needs but also align with sustainability goals.

Key Features to Consider in Industrial Light Towers
When selecting an industrial light tower, understanding its key features can greatly influence the performance and functionality you can expect. One of the most critical aspects is the light output measured in lumens. Higher lumens indicate brighter lights, which is essential for large outdoor areas or construction sites. Typically, light towers with 20,000 lumens or more are suited for larger operations while smaller projects may only require 10,000 to 15,000 lumens. Ensure that the chosen tower not only meets your brightness needs but also complies with safety standards.
Another important feature is the fuel type and efficiency of the light tower. Diesel, gas, and solar-powered light towers each have their advantages depending on the application. Diesel towers are favored for their longevity and ability to run for extended hours without refueling, making them suitable for remote locations. Gas-powered towers tend to be lighter and easier to transport but require more frequent refueling. Solar-powered options are eco-friendly and cost-effective for areas with ample sunlight, but they may not provide consistent power during cloudy days.
Stability and portability are also key features worth considering. A stable base is crucial for safety, especially in windy conditions or uneven terrain. Look for models with adjustable legs or added weight options for enhanced stability. Additionally, portability should not be overlooked; light towers equipped with wheels or compact design can save time during setup and breakdown, making them ideal for mobile applications or projects that require frequent relocation.
Maintenance Tips for Industrial Light Towers
Proper maintenance of industrial light towers is essential for ensuring their longevity and optimal performance. Regular inspections should be part of the maintenance routine to check for any wear and tear on the electrical components, lighting elements, and fuel systems. Scheduled checks can help identify issues before they escalate, thereby saving costs on repairs and downtime. Always refer to the manufacturer’s guidelines on maintenance intervals to keep the equipment in the best condition.
Cleaning is another important aspect of maintenance. Dust, dirt, and grime can accumulate on the light fixtures, diminishing their brightness and overall effectiveness over time. Use a soft cloth or sponge and suitable cleaning agents to wipe down the fixtures regularly. For models with lenses, ensure they are clear and free from obstructions, as this can drastically impact lighting quality. Additionally, check and clean the fuel system regularly, as contaminants can lead to operational issues in the long run.
Another crucial maintenance tip involves checking the battery and electrical systems, especially for electric or hybrid models. Batteries should be charged regularly and replaced as specified in the manufacturer’s instructions to avoid performance failures. Store all parts in a secure, dry area when not in use, and take precautions against extreme weather conditions that can affect the equipment. Adhering to these maintenance tips will not only prolong the life of your light tower but also ensure safety and efficiency during use.

Environmental Considerations for Industrial Light Towers
As industries increasingly focus on sustainability, environmental considerations have become a significant factor in the design and operation of industrial light towers. Traditional diesel-powered towers, while effective, emit greenhouse gases and contribute to air pollution. Consequently, there’s a growing shift towards using electric and solar-powered light towers that reduce carbon footprints and improve energy efficiency. These greener options also offer reduced operating costs over time, making them attractive to environmentally-conscious businesses.
Additionally, considerations around noise pollution have prompted advancements in the design of light towers. Older diesel models often produce significant noise, which can be disruptive in urban areas or residential zones. Newer models prioritize quieter operation, allowing for their use in noise-sensitive environments without disturbing nearby communities. This focus on reducing noise pollution is becoming increasingly relevant, especially as regulatory pressures around industrial operations mount.
Moreover, the construction of light towers is also evolving. Manufacturers are using recyclable materials and designing products to minimize waste throughout their life cycle. Those interested in minimizing their environmental impact should look for light towers that come with energy-efficient features, modular designs, and manufacturers committed to sustainable practices. By considering these environmental factors, businesses can align their operational practices with broader sustainability goals while still maintaining productivity and safety.

5. Are LED light towers better than traditional models?
LED light towers generally outperform traditional models in several key areas, offering advantages such as increased energy efficiency, longer lifespan, and lower maintenance costs. LED lights consume significantly less energy than halogen or metal halide bulbs, allowing for extended operation times without frequent refueling or recharging. This efficiency translates to lower operating costs over the life of the unit.
In terms of brightness and quality of light, LED fixtures provide a higher lumen output per watt, meaning they produce more light while using less energy. Furthermore, LED lights have a longer lifespan, often rated for up to 50,000 hours, compared to the 1,000–2,000 hours typical of traditional bulbs. This durability reduces the frequency and cost of replacement, making LED light towers a smart long-term investment.

7. How do I safely operate an industrial light tower?
To safely operate an industrial light tower, begin by ensuring that all operators are familiar with the manufacturer’s guidelines and safety instructions. When setting up the light tower, choose a stable, level surface to avoid tipping or collapse. Make sure all legs and supports are securely stabilized before raising the mast to its full height. Additionally, assess the environmental conditions and avoid using the light tower in high winds or adverse weather.
When in use, position the light tower away from high-traffic areas and ensure that pathways and working areas are well-lit to minimize accidents. Always use caution when operating electrical equipment—avoid contact with wet surfaces and do not use the tower if there are visible damages or malfunctions. Regular safety checks will promote a secure working environment while maximizing the effectiveness of the light tower.
